Transaction 4c665d85a709437fd1b3369bd51d142d95ff211ea24b92c4cb3a0ff79e5ccb7e

1 Input
2 Outputs
  • 4c665d85a709437fd1b3369bd51d142d95ff211ea24b92c4cb3a0ff79e5ccb7e:0
  • value  9779
    address  14td7MLmhDUKw3679nsDHtQ3z6Nrff5eFN
  • 4c665d85a709437fd1b3369bd51d142d95ff211ea24b92c4cb3a0ff79e5ccb7e:1
  • value  58256
    address  14TvdWe7KYkiSwTGmkriLXBNQDgaNgwtmS